Understanding Air Brake Systems
Commercial trucks rely on sophisticated air brake systems to ensure safe and efficient braking. These systems utilize compressed air to apply pressure to brake chambers, forcing brake shoes or pads against the brake drums or rotors. Unlike traditional hydraulic brake systems, air brakes offer several advantages, including greater stopping power, improved heat dissipation, and enhanced reliability in demanding conditions.
Components of an Air Brake System
An air brake system comprises several interconnected components, each playing a vital role in the braking process:
- Compressor: Generates compressed air, the driving force behind the braking action.
- Air Tanks: Store compressed air for immediate use during braking.
- Control Valves: Regulate the flow of air to and from the brake chambers.
- Brake Chambers: Receive compressed air and convert it into mechanical force to apply the brakes.
- Brake Lines: Transport compressed air from the compressor to the brake chambers.

The Air Brake Test Procedure
The air brake test procedure typically involves a series of steps designed to evaluate the functionality of all system components:
Visual Inspection
A thorough visual inspection of all air brake components is conducted to identify any obvious signs of damage, wear, or leaks.
Air Pressure Check
The air pressure in the air tanks is measured to ensure it meets the specified requirements.
Brake Application and Release Test
The brakes are applied and released multiple times to verify proper operation and responsiveness.
Leak Test
A leak test is performed to detect any air leaks in the system, which can compromise braking performance.
Brake Chamber Adjustment
